MSOC: TWolves Earn First Point of 2026 After a Fiery Draw with UFV

Box Score Sunday afternoon at Masich Place Stadium, the UNBC Timberwolves earned their first point of the 2026 Canada West campaign, battling the visiting UFV Cascades to a fiery 1-1 draw. Hagon Kim delivered a memorable defensive performance to take home Mr. Mikes Player of the Game honors, highlighted by an airborne, goal-line clearance that kept the T-Wolves in command.
 
The Timberwolves set an aggressive tempo right from kickoff. In the second minute, Kim swung in a dangerous corner that found Koss Nystedt, whose header sailed just over the crossbar. Ten minutes later, Simon Odenthal drove deep into the 18-yard box, nearly breaking through before a desperate UFV slide tackle disrupted the chance.
 
UNBC's relentless forecheck paid dividends in the 16th minute. After forcing a turnover in the Cascades' defensive third, Mehdi Bounaaja slipped a pinpoint pass from the right flank across to James Jordan. With the UFV goalkeeper rushing out, Jordan calmly slotted the ball home to give UNBC a 1-0 lead—marking his second goal in as many games to start the season.
 
The Timberwolves continued to pour on the pressure, testing UFV goalkeeper Matheus de Souza with another Nystedt header off a Kim cross. In the 36th minute, following a UNBC corner delivered by Trevor Scott, the Cascades launched a sudden counter-attack. UFV's striker broke in, but UNBC goalkeeper Callum Cuthbert came up with a split-save. The rebound looped high toward the open net, where UFV's Nathan Cervo directed a header on frame. In a moment of pure brilliance, Kim cleared the ball off the goal line with a stunning mid-air kick to preserve the 1-0 lead heading into the break.
 
UNBC maintained control early in the second half, generating a pair of close chances around the hour mark. Luis Beck anchored the backline with crucial clearances, while Cuthbert came up with a sharp stop in the 73rd minute. However, UFV found their equalizer seconds later when Ebi Igali headed home a corner kick to level the match at 1-1.
 
The intensity soared down the final stretch as the Timberwolves pushed for a winner. Luis Hirsch came up with a clutch stop inside the box in the 81st minute, sparking a counter-attack led by Kaiden Young. Young sprinted into open turf before being brought down hard by Igali, prompting the referee to show the UFV goalscorer a straight red card. With UFV down to 10 men, tempers flared again in the 88th minute when Cascades star Mateo Brazinha shoved a UNBC player, earning UFV a second red card and reducing the visitors to nine men.
 
Despite an all-out UNBC siege during three minutes of stoppage time, the Cascades held on to split the points.
